Hinge Replacement

Hinge replacement in Covina is rarely a simple bolt-off, bolt-on job. In the older residential blocks of central and east Covina, many original 1960s wrought iron swing gates are still pinned into the same concrete block posts they were installed in. Decades of hard-water mineral deposits from the Main San Gabriel Basin supply have effectively fused the hinge pintles to the post sleeves. Hinge extraction and sleeve replacement has become a near-universal first step on repair calls here rather than an occasional extra. We cut out the seized assembly, install a new stainless steel bushing, and hang the gate on hardware that won’t seize again.

Post Replacement

Concrete block and brick pilasters are the standard gate post in Covina’s 1950s–1970s housing stock, and they’re failing in predictable ways. Mortar anchor points deteriorate. Rebar inside the block rusts and expands, cracking the face. We replace or rebuild posts with proper drainage and galvanized anchor hardware, then weld new mounting plates directly to restored iron frames. A typical post replacement in Covina runs $340–$580.

Rail Repair

Wrought iron rails on Covina’s older gates suffer from galvanic corrosion where dissimilar metals meet—steel pickets in aluminum frames, iron posts with steel fasteners. Summer heat above 100°F accelerates the chemical reaction. We cut out corroded sections, fabricate matching replacements in our mobile welding rig, and finish with rust-inhibiting primer. Rail repair in Covina typically costs $220–$450 depending on linear footage.

Common Gate Parts & Welding Problems We See in Covina Homes

  • Hard-water mineral fusion seizes hinge pintles to post sleeves. The Main San Gabriel Basin groundwater leaves calcium and mineral deposits that effectively weld the hinge to its sleeve over 50–70 years. Extraction requires cutting, drilling, and sleeve replacement—never just a new hinge.
  • Summer heat above 100°F expands original 1950s slide gate tracks. Steel tracks laid decades ago lack expansion joints. When inland Covina hits 108°F, the track bows slightly and the gate rollers bind. We cut relief gaps or replace with modern aluminum track systems.
  • Santa Ana winds slam unlatched gates, accelerating fatigue failure. Wind events funnel through the San Gabriel Valley corridor with particular force, repeatedly stressing drop rods, gate arms, and hinges already weakened by corrosion. The damage is cumulative and often invisible until sudden failure.
  • Galvanic corrosion at dissimilar metal junctions. Original wrought iron gates with steel fasteners or aluminum frame inserts corrode fastest where the metals touch. We see this constantly in Covina’s 91723 ZIP code, where 1960s tract homes used whatever hardware was cheapest at the time.
